What Are Dental Sealants and How Do They Protect Your Teeth?
Dental sealants are a preventive dental treatment that involves applying a thin layer of a plastic material to the chewing surfaces of teeth, particularly molars and premolars. This coating acts as a barrier, sealing the pits and fissures where food particles and bacteria can accumulate, thus preventing cavities. The application of sealants is a quick and painless procedure that can significantly reduce the risk of tooth decay.
What materials are used in dental sealants?
Dental sealants are typically made from two main types of materials: resin-based composites and glass ionomer. Resin-based composites are the most common choice due to their durability and ease of application, although they are usually clear or white rather than color-matched to the natural tooth. Glass ionomer sealants, on the other hand, release fluoride, which can help protect the tooth from decay. Both materials effectively seal the tooth surface, but the choice may depend on the specific needs of the patient.

How do sealants prevent cavities on molars and premolars?
Sealants prevent cavities by filling in the grooves and pits on the chewing surfaces of molars and premolars, which are difficult to clean with a toothbrush. By sealing these areas, sealants block food particles and bacteria from entering, significantly reducing the likelihood of decay. Studies have shown that sealants can reduce the risk of cavities by about 60% in children over a period of 2 to 3 years, making them an essential part of preventive dentistry.

Dental Sealant Effectiveness & Retention for Cavity Prevention
The aim of this study was to compare the caries-preventive effect and the retention rates of sealants prepared with a new modified and a high-viscosity glass-ionomer cement (GIC) in recently erupted first permanent molars. Fifty-six children (224 teeth) were included in a split-mouth randomised clinical trial. All children had their four first permanent molars sealed with either Clinpro XT Varnish (CXT) or Fuji IX GP FAST (FJ). Retention rates and caries-preventive effect of both materials were assessed clinically after 24 months.
Retention rates and caries-preventive effects of two different sealant materials: a randomised clinical trial, J Faber, 2018

How much can dental sealants reduce the risk of tooth decay?
Research indicates that dental sealants can reduce the risk of tooth decay by about 60% over 2 to 3 years after application. Over time, they continue to provide protection, although regular dental check-ups are essential to ensure their integrity. This significant reduction in cavity risk highlights the importance of sealants as a preventive measure in dental care.
Are dental sealants a cost-effective preventive treatment?
Yes, dental sealants are a cost-effective preventive treatment. The initial cost of sealant application is much lower than the cost of treating cavities, which can involve fillings, crowns, or even root canals. Many dental insurance plans cover sealants, especially for children, making them an accessible option for families looking to maintain their children’s oral health.
Who Should Consider Dental Sealants? Benefits for Children and Adults
Dental sealants are beneficial for both children and adults, although their application is particularly recommended for children aged 6 to 14, when their permanent molars and premolars erupt.
Why are dental sealants important for children aged 6 to 11?
Children in this age group are at a higher risk for cavities due to their developing oral hygiene habits. Sealants provide a protective barrier during this critical time, helping to prevent decay in newly erupted molars. The application of sealants can be a proactive step in ensuring long-term dental health for children.
Can adults benefit from dental sealants?
Yes, adults can also benefit from dental sealants, especially those who are at higher risk for cavities due to factors such as dry mouth, gum disease, or a history of dental issues. Sealants can provide additional protection for adults’ molars, helping to maintain their oral health as they age.
What Is the Dental Sealant Application Procedure at Rudy Aldaragi DDS?

The application of dental sealants is a straightforward process that can typically be completed in one visit to the dentist.
What are the step-by-step stages of sealant application?
- Cleaning the Teeth: The dentist will clean the teeth to remove any plaque or debris.
- Preparing the Tooth Surface: An acidic solution (etchant) is applied to the tooth surface to help the sealant bond effectively.
- Applying the Sealant: The sealant material is painted onto the tooth surface, filling in the grooves and pits.
- Curing the Sealant: A special light may be used to harden the sealant, ensuring it adheres properly to the tooth.
What should patients expect during and after the procedure?
Patients can expect a quick and painless procedure, typically lasting about 30 minutes. After application, there may be a slight adjustment period as the patient becomes accustomed to the feel of the sealants. Regular dental check-ups will help monitor the condition of the sealants and ensure they remain effective.
How Long Do Dental Sealants Last and How Should You Maintain Them?
The longevity of dental sealants can vary based on several factors, including oral hygiene practices and dietary habits.
What is the typical lifespan of dental sealants?
On average, dental sealants can last between 5 to 10 years, but they require regular dental check-ups to assess their condition and determine if reapplication is necessary. Factors such as grinding teeth or consuming hard foods can affect their lifespan.

Fluoride Release from Dental Sealant Materials
To measure the amounts of fluoride released from fluoride-containing materials, four glass ionomer cements (Fuji IX, Fuji VII, Fuji IX Extra and Fuji II LC), a compomer (Dyract Extra) and a giomer (Beautifil) were used in this study. Twenty cylindrical specimens were prepared from each material. The amount of released fluoride was measured during the first week and on the days 14 and 21 by using specific fluoride electrode and an ionanalyzer.
Fluoride release by glass ionomer cements, compomer and giomer, SM Mousavinasab, 2009
How can patients maintain sealants for optimal cavity prevention?
To maintain dental sealants, patients should practice good oral hygiene, including regular brushing and flossing. Additionally, routine dental visits for professional cleanings and examinations will help ensure that the sealants remain intact and effective in preventing cavities.
